MECHANICAL PENCIL

A mechanical pencil has: a shaft tube; a ferrule unit supported by the shaft tube; a lead holding unit having a chuck configured to relatively move with respect to the ferrule unit to eject lead held by the same; and an indication body provided movably in an axial direction. The indication body delimits from rearward a lead storage space formed rearward the chuck in the shaft tube. The indication body located at least at a predetermined position is viewable from outside the shaft tube. A length along the axial direction between a rear end of the lead storage space and a front end of the ferrule unit, in a state where the indication body has moved most rearward along the axial direction, is equal to or more than twice a length of spare lead to be stored in the lead storage space.

INDUCTOR CORE, ELECTRONIC PEN, AND INPUT DEVICE
20220363087 · 2022-11-17 ·

An inductor core includes a magnetic main body having a pillar shape and comprised of a magnetic material. The magnetic main body includes an inclined portion including an inclined surface that constitutes an outer circumferential surface of a truncated cone having an outer diameter increasing from one end toward the other end; and a straight body portion that is coaxial with the inclined portion and includes an outer peripheral surface that constitutes an outer circumferential surface of a cylindrical column body extending from the other end toward the one end, the straight body portion being connected to the inclined portion. An arithmetic mean roughness Ra of an outer peripheral surface of the straight body portion located at or around the other end is smaller than an arithmetic mean roughness Ra of an outer peripheral surface of the straight body portion that is disposed at or around the inclined portion.

MECHANICAL PENCIL HAVING LEAD BREAKAGE-PREVENTION MECHANISM
20220363086 · 2022-11-17 ·

A mechanical pencil has a main body housing a lead-feeding mechanism which includes a chuck and a clamping ring. A tapered member is provided at a front end of the main body, and a slider is mounted to undergo back and forth movement within the tapered member. A lead protection pipe protrudes from a front end of the tapered member when the slider moves forward, and an outer pipe is provided at a front end of the tapered member and surrounds a front end of the lead protection pipe. The slider moves backward as the writing proceeds so the lead protection pipe is not bent by a writing pressure, whereby a lead can be fed by a few knocking operations. The outer pipe is fixed to the tapered member or provided on an outer pipe holder inserted into the tapered member. The outer pipe holder is fixed to the inside of the tapered member or disposed to move back and forth in the tapered member.

Mechanical pencil
09834032 · 2017-12-05 · ·

A mechanical pencil which is configured so that a rotatable cam is rotationally driven with an axis of the rotatable cam relative to a holder member stabled, and smooth operation of a rotational drive mechanism is ensured. The mechanical pencil includes a rotational drive mechanism for driving rotationally a rotatable cam according to writing pressure applied to a writing lead, and transfer rotational motion of the rotatable cam to the writing lead. The rotational drive mechanism includes a holder member supporting the rotatable cam so as to be rotatable, a first fixed cam formed with a funnel-shaped inclined surface Fu and a second fixed cam formed at an obtuse angle α relative to an axial direction. Cam faces of an upper cam and a lower cam alternately meshing with the first and second fixed cams are formed along a conical inclined surface Cs.

Mechanical pencil
09738112 · 2017-08-22 · ·

A mechanical pencil is including a tubular shaft, a chuck unit movably arranged in the shaft, a front rotary element adapted to be moved rearward as the unit is moved rearward, a rear rotary element adapted to be moved rearward as the front rotary element is moved rearward, a conversion means for causing the rear rotary element to rotate in a normal rotational direction as the rear rotary element is moved rearward and allowing the rear rotary element to rotate in a reverse rotational direction as the rear rotary element is moved forward, a normal directional rotation transmitting means for allowing the front rotary element to be rotated in the normal rotational direction and the rear rotary element to be idly rotated, and a reverse directional rotation restricting mechanism allowing the normal directional rotation of the front rotary element but preventing the reverse directional rotation of the front rotary element.
